May 26, 2025

Authoritarian Parenting vs Gentle Parenting: Weighing Parenting Styles for Children in 2025

<strong>Authoritarian Parenting vs Gentle Parenting: Weighing Parenting Styles for Children in 2025</strong> image

As society evolves, so do parenting trends both in Indonesia and worldwide. While authoritarian parenting was once the standard, gentle parenting is now gaining popularity among many modern families. The debate about authoritarian parenting vs gentle parenting raises an important question: which approach is more effective for shaping a child’s character in today’s digital age?

This article explores the core differences between authoritarian parenting and gentle parenting, discusses the strengths and weaknesses of each, and offers guidance on how parents can choose or even blend these approaches to best suit their children and family needs.

What is Authoritarian Parenting?

Authoritarian parenting is rooted in traditional values where discipline, obedience, and clear hierarchy are emphasized within the family. Parents take on a leadership role that is to be respected, while children are expected to follow rules and instructions with minimal negotiation. This style is characterized by strict rules, consequences for disobedience, and one-way communication, where the child’s opinion often holds little weight.

Key features include:

  • Non-negotiable rules set by parents
  • Punishments or consequences for breaking rules
  • Limited space for children to express their opinions
  • A strong focus on achievement, independence, and resilience

Gentle Parenting: A Contrasting Approach

On the other hand, gentle parenting centers on empathy, open communication, and emotional support. Parents act as guides and companions rather than strict authority figures. Gentle parenting encourages children to be confident, expressive, and emotionally intelligent.

This approach still involves boundaries, but they are established through understanding and dialogue rather than rigid control. Consistency, emotional validation, and positive reinforcement are the pillars of gentle parenting.

Strengths and Weaknesses of Authoritarian Parenting

authoritarian parenting

As a classic style, authoritarian parenting is still used by many because it is believed to foster discipline and independence. Children raised with this approach often adapt well to rules and cope under pressure. However, there are risks: this method can make children afraid to make their own decisions, less self-confident, and reluctant to express their feelings or opinions.

Gentle parenting, meanwhile, is often seen as more suitable for today’s tech-savvy generation. However, if not balanced with clear boundaries, it can leave children uncertain about rules and appropriate behavior.

Authoritarian Parenting in the Digital Age: Challenges and Adaptation

In this era of instant information, social media, and rapid cultural shifts, authoritarian parenting faces new challenges. Today’s children are exposed to more ideas and influences than ever before. While discipline and boundaries remain essential, parents also need to update their communication style so that children feel heard and understood.

A blended approach—combining the structure of authoritarian parenting with the empathy and communication of gentle parenting—can help children become both resilient and emotionally healthy.

Tips for Balancing Parenting Styles

Here are some tips for keeping parenting effective in the modern age:

  • Create Rules Together: Involve your child in setting family rules and explain the reasons behind them.
  • Be Consistent but Open: Stick to important rules but be willing to adapt as your child grows.
  • Validate Emotions: Listen to your child’s feelings and help them understand their emotions, even when maintaining discipline.
  • Encourage Two-Way Dialogue: Give space for your child to share thoughts and concerns, not just receive instructions.
  • Lead by Example: Show discipline, honesty, and responsibility in your own actions.

Preparing Children for the Future

When adapted thoughtfully, authoritarian parenting can help children develop the discipline, responsibility, and independence they’ll need for success in school, friendships, and future careers. However, don’t forget to also nurture their emotional and creative sides for a well-rounded upbringing.

Nurture Future Skills with Timedoor Academy

Ingin tahu detail program? Image

Ingin tahu detail program?

No matter which parenting style you choose, giving your child valuable skills for the future is essential. Coding, for example, is now a foundation for many modern professions. At Timedoor Academy, children can learn coding in a fun and interactive way, building logic, creativity, and problem-solving skills.

Timedoor Academy offers a free trial class so your child can experience coding before joining the regular program. With expert teachers and a child-friendly curriculum, your child will be ready to adapt and thrive in the world ahead.

Start a new adventure with Timedoor Academy today—sign up your child and help open the door to a brighter, opportunity-filled future.!

Keep Reading

cara membangun rasa percaya diri anak
How to Build Confidence for Kids: Fun Activities Using Technology and Coding
Learning how to build confidence for kids is one of the most important things parents and educators can do today. Confidence helps children try new activities, solve problems, and handle challenges with resilience. When we focus on how to build confidence for kids early, we prepare them to succeed in a rapidly changing, technology-driven world. In this article, we explore practical ways on how to build confidence for kids, especially by introducing technology and coding as fun, valuable tools. 1. Encourage Participation in Sports and Tech Competitions One of the proven ways on how to build confidence for kids is through healthy competition. Sports teach teamwork and leadership, while technology competitions like coding contests, robotics challenges, and game design tournaments also foster self-belief and perseverance. Participating in both physical sports and tech-based activities strengthens how to build confidence for kids by showing them their hard work can lead to real achievements, whether on the field or in the digital world. 2. Introduce Creative Arts and Digital Creation Creative expression plays a major role in how to build confidence for kids. Traditional arts like painting and music are important, but digital creativity is just as powerful. Kids can design digital art, create animations, or develop their own simple apps. Coding empowers them to build real projects they can proudly share. By blending creative arts with technology, we make how to build confidence for kids even more exciting and relevant to today's world. 3. Promote Public Speaking and Tech Presentations Another essential strategy for how to build confidence for kids is encouraging them to present ideas, especially tech-related projects. Whether it's demonstrating a coding project, showcasing a simple game they built, or explaining a robotics experiment, these presentations strengthen communication skills. When kids explain technology in their own words, they not only become more confident but also realize the value of their knowledge — an important part of how to build confidence for kids. 4. Teach Coding to Build Problem-Solving Skills Teaching coding is a highly effective method on how to build confidence for kids. Through coding, kids learn to break down complex problems, experiment with solutions, and celebrate successes when they see their projects come to life. Every error they fix and every program they build adds to their sense of achievement. Platforms like Scratch, Minecraft Education, and beginner coding classes allow children to experience firsthand how to build confidence for kids in a way that’s fun, interactive, and empowering. 5. Celebrate Tech-Driven Small Achievements Celebrating small wins is key to how to build confidence for kids. This could mean finishing their first coding project, debugging a tricky error, or creating their first animation. Recognizing achievements in the tech space shows kids that every step counts. Praising their effort in technology projects builds a habit of perseverance and reinforces how to build confidence for kids even when challenges arise. 6. Provide Leadership Opportunities in Technology Leadership experiences are essential when thinking about how to build confidence for kids. Letting kids mentor others in coding clubs, lead a small tech workshop, or present a group project boosts their self-esteem and teaches valuable collaboration skills. Being seen as a “tech leader” among their peers strengthens how to build confidence for kids and encourages them to take pride in their abilities. 7. Encourage Independent Tech Projects Encouraging kids to explore independent technology projects is another way on how to build confidence for kids. Whether it's coding their own mini-game, building a basic website, or programming a simple robot, independent projects help children develop critical thinking and ownership. Solving problems without heavy adult assistance shows them they are capable and resourceful — a huge part of how to build confidence for kids. Building Lifelong Confidence Through Technology and Experiences Understanding how to build confidence for kids means offering opportunities across many areas, especially in the digital world. Technology and coding empower kids to think creatively, solve problems, and take pride in their achievements. Whether it’s through sports, public speaking, creative arts, or tech projects, helping kids see their own potential is crucial. By focusing on how to build confidence for kids early, we prepare them to face the future with strength, curiosity, and joy. At Timedoor Academy, we specialize in helping children build confidence through fun coding and technology programs. If you want your child to experience firsthand how to build confidence for kids with exciting tech activities, sign up for a free trial class today!
Benefits of Coding for Kids: The Long-Term Advantages of Early Coding Education
Benefits of Coding for Kids: The Long-Term Advantages of Early Coding Education
In today’s digital era, coding skills are no longer just technical abilities—they have become essential assets for facing future challenges. That’s why many parents and educators are beginning to recognize the benefits of coding for kids from an early age. Coding education not only helps children understand technology but also offers numerous long-term advantages that are valuable for their development, both academically and in everyday life.   1. Enhancing Critical Thinking and Problem-Solving Skills One of the most important benefits of coding for kids is its ability to train critical thinking and problem-solving skills. When learning to code, children are taught how to break down large problems into smaller, manageable parts and to find logical and systematic solutions. This process helps kids develop analytical and creative thinking, which proves useful across various life situations and academic fields.   2. Fostering Creativity and Self-Expression Many people think of coding as a rigid activity filled with lines of code, but in reality, coding can be very creative. Through coding, kids can build exciting projects such as games, animations, and apps. This allows them to express their ideas and imagination in tangible ways using technology. This benefit of coding for kids is crucial so they become not only technology users but also creators.   3. Preparing Kids for the Future Job Market With rapid technological advancements, many future jobs will require coding as a key skill. By introducing coding early, children will be better prepared to face changes in the world and global competition. The benefits of coding for kids here lie in giving them a competitive edge to adapt to an increasingly digital and automated workforce.   4. Improving Focus and Attention to Detail Learning to code also demands that kids focus and pay attention to every line of code to ensure the program runs smoothly. This habit builds patience and sharpens their ability to notice details. With enhanced concentration, children can improve their performance in other subjects because they become accustomed to working carefully and systematically.   5. Strengthening Collaboration and Communication Skills Although coding may seem like an individual activity, many coding projects require teamwork. Kids learn how to communicate clearly, share ideas, and collaborate to solve problems. This benefit of coding for kids helps them develop important social skills and prepares them to work in dynamic, collaborative environments.   6. Boosting Confidence and Independence When children successfully complete a coding project, such as creating a simple game or application, they experience a sense of achievement that boosts their confidence. Moreover, coding teaches kids to learn independently, find solutions on their own when problems arise, and to persevere. These benefits of coding for kids are valuable in shaping strong character and resilience.   Start Coding Education for Kids at Timedoor Academy With all these important benefits of coding for kids, there’s no reason to delay introducing coding early. Timedoor Academy offers the best solution for parents who want to provide quality coding education to their children. The learning programs at Timedoor Academy are designed to be fun and interactive, so kids don’t just learn coding—they enjoy the process. We also offer free trial classes so your child can try and experience the benefits of coding for kids firsthand before making a commitment. Register your child now and help them develop skills that will be incredibly useful for their future! By giving children the chance to learn coding as early as possible, you’re opening doors for them to maximize their potential and be ready for the challenges of the digital age. Remember, the benefits of coding for kids go beyond technical skills—they’re about shaping mindset, creativity, and strong character. So don’t wait any longer—take advantage of coding education at Timedoor Academy and see the positive changes in your child!
<strong>Why Learning Coding While Playing Games for Kids is a Brilliant Choice</strong>
Why Learning Coding While Playing Games for Kids is a Brilliant Choice
In today’s digital age, technological skills are no longer optional but essential. Children who grow up surrounded by digital tools will be much better prepared for the future if they gain a basic understanding of technology. One of the most enjoyable and effective ways to introduce technology to children is through learning coding while playing games for kids. This approach combines entertainment with education, allowing children to have fun while gaining valuable knowledge. Is Coding Suitable for Children? Many parents may still wonder if coding is appropriate for elementary school children. Questions like, “Can my child really understand programming concepts?” often arises. The answer is yes, because with learning coding while playing games for kids, complex material can be delivered in simple and interactive ways. Children do not need to grasp complicated math formulas right away. Instead, they are introduced to logical thinking and problem-solving through something they already love: playing games. Developing Critical and Creative Thinking One of the greatest benefits of learning coding while playing games for kids is how this method encourages critical thinking. While playing, children encounter specific challenges that require them to find solutions. For example, coding-based games often feature characters that move only when the player arranges the correct instructions. This trains children to think systematically and creatively at the same time. Building Collaboration Skills In addition to critical thinking, this approach also fosters collaboration. Many coding platforms for children provide multiplayer features or sharing forums. Kids can exchange ideas, learn from peers, and enjoy the social benefits of learning coding while playing games for kids. They are not only learning about technology but also practicing communication and teamwork, which are equally important for their future. Increasing Motivation to Learn Early On Equally important, this method boosts intrinsic motivation. Children often get bored when learning is presented in conventional forms. However, when the experience feels like play, their curiosity grows. Every challenge in the game provides a sense of achievement that motivates them to continue. In other words, learning coding while playing games for kids is not only fun but also builds positive learning habits. Insights from Education Experts Education experts also support this method. They emphasize that 21st-century skills such as digital literacy, creativity, and problem-solving can be developed effectively through interactive learning. If parents want their children to be future-ready in a world full of technology, then choosing learning coding while playing games for kids is a wise decision. The Role of Parents in Supporting Children Of course, parents play a crucial role in supporting this journey. Accompanying children while they learn, offering encouragement when they face difficulties, and appreciating every small achievement will make the process more meaningful. With active parental involvement, the benefits of learning coding while playing games for kids can be fully maximized. Timedoor Academy and Creative Curriculum Timedoor Academy understands the importance of fun and relevant learning methods for the younger generation. The coding programs offered are designed specifically for children, combining the excitement of games with programming principles. Kids not only learn to create simple commands but also get the chance to design their own games. This makes every step of learning feel like a new adventure. Enroll Your Child at Timedoor Academy! If you want your child to grow with strong future-ready skills, now is the perfect time to start. Enroll your child in the Free Trial program at Timedoor Academy and experience how coding can be both fun and meaningful. Click the registration button today and give your child the best opportunity to thrive.
float button